Travellers Warn of Lengthy Immigration Queues at West Kowloon High-Speed Rail Terminus Ahead of Labour-day Peak
A Reddit thread posted 15 March warns that West Kowloon Station’s joint Hong Kong–Mainland immigration hall is already experiencing heavy waits and will likely be overwhelmed during the Labour-day holidays. Corporate travellers are advised to factor in longer clearance times or use alternative land borders to avoid missed connections and meeting delays.
Skypier Ferry Cancellation Forces Hong Kong Airport Transit Passengers to Reroute via Land Border
The cancellation of HKIA’s 09:00 Skypier ferry to Guangzhou on 15 March left transit passengers facing an eight-hour wait or the complex option of clearing Hong Kong immigration and switching to land transport. The incident highlights the fragility of the airport’s air-sea transfer network and the need for contingency planning by corporate mobility teams.
